Position:
CORPORATE SECURITY MANAGER
General Statement of Duties:
This is a responsible supervisory security management
position which will require an aggressive individual
who will oversee and coordinate all security efforts
across a mid sized cruise management company,
including information technology, human resources,
communications, facilities management, reservations
call center, on board ship security teams and
other groups, and will identify security initiatives,
policies and set standards. Individual must
have a clear understanding of modern security
principles, anti-terrorism procedures and the
ISPS Code as it applies to both ship and port
facilities security operations.
Principle Activities/Responsibilities:
- Identify existing security weaknesses and
execute solutions for corporate-level improvements
in security, safety, quality control, productivity
and overall cost reduction.
- Oversee a network of security personnel and
vendors who safeguard the company's assets,
intellectual property and ships, as well as
the physical safety of employees and visitors.
- Identify protection goals and objectives
consistent with corporate strategic plan and
produce the corporate security strategic plan.
- Manage the development and implementation
of global security policy, standards, guidelines
and procedures to ensure ongoing maintenance
of security.
- Maintain relationships with local, state,
federal and international enforcement agencies
and other related government services focused
on maritime security.
- Oversee the investigation of security breaches
and assist with disciplinary and legal matters
associated with such breaches as necessary.
- Work with outside consultants as appropriate
for independent security audits.
- Evaluate capital security equipment investments,
establish the corporate security budget and
justify annual cost estimates.
- Advise the level of threats likely to be encountered
by the corporate facilities and ships, using
appropriate security assessments and other relevant
information.
- Ensure the development, submission for approval,
and thereafter implementation and maintenance
of the company's SSAs and SSPs.
- Arrange for corporate-wide internal audits
and reviews of security activities.
- Arrange for the initial and subsequent verifications
of the company's ships by the administration
or the RSO.
- Ensure that deficiencies and non-conformities
identified during internal audits, periodic
reviews, security inspections and verifications
of compliance are promptly addressed and dealt
with in a prompt and effective manner.
- Ensure adequate training for all personnel
responsible for the security of the company's
assets, facilities and ships.
- Ensure consistency between security requirements
and safety requirements for all company facilities
and ships.
QUALIFICATIONS & REQUIREMENTS:
- Bachelor's Degree
- Minimum of five (5) years and preferably eight
(8) years experience in the management and supervision
of corporate-level security operations of a
200+ employee corporation.
- Clear understanding of the ISPS Code, SOLAS,
CFR, and maritime international laws. CSO, SSO
and PFSO certifications per ISPS Code is a plus.
- The position is largely self-directed, requires
supervision of at least twenty (20) security
team members and demands an ability to prioritize,
set and keep commitments and handle a changing
dynamic work environment.
- Time management skills, a demand for teamwork
and a commitment to quality are necessary skills.
